Aldi has been a slow evolution for me.

I went in out of curiosity probably a year ago, and ever since have found myself getting more and more stuff from there.

Some of there stuff I don't like, but for breads/most cereals/snacks and whatnot the prices are awesome. I generally only buy 1 or 2 new things at a time in case I end up pitching them (as opposed to a whole shopping load).

I find word of mouth has really helped them grow. Low prices is one thing, but alot of the food actually tastes good which comes as a surprise to many.

If I was raising 2-3 kids that store would be a God send when I think about what our food bills used to be like when I was a kid (had 2 other siblings).
